Core Capabilities: From Monitoring to Policy Enforcement

Teramind's AI Governance platform offers several key capabilities designed specifically for enterprise Windows environments:

Real-time AI Activity Monitoring
The platform captures detailed logs of AI agent interactions across endpoints, including which AI tools are being used, what data is being processed, and how AI-generated content is being utilized. This includes monitoring of popular AI services like Microsoft Copilot, ChatGPT Enterprise, and custom AI implementations integrated with Windows applications.

Policy-Based Control Framework
Organizations can establish granular policies governing AI usage, including data classification rules that prevent sensitive information from being processed by unauthorized AI tools. The platform supports conditional policies based on user roles, data sensitivity, and business context, allowing for flexible governance that doesn't unnecessarily hinder productivity.

Comprehensive Audit Trails
Every AI interaction generates a detailed audit trail that includes user identification, timestamp, AI tool used, input data characteristics, and output results. These trails are essential for compliance reporting, incident investigation, and demonstrating due diligence in AI governance practices.

Risk Scoring and Alerting
The platform employs AI-driven analytics to identify potentially risky AI behaviors, such as attempts to process restricted data categories or unusual patterns of AI usage that might indicate policy violations or security threats.

Implementation Considerations for Windows Administrators

For IT teams managing Windows environments, implementing AI governance requires careful planning:

Performance Impact Assessment
Initial testing should evaluate the platform's impact on endpoint performance, particularly for resource-intensive applications. Search results indicate that modern endpoint monitoring solutions typically have minimal performance overhead when properly configured.

User Experience Balancing
Overly restrictive AI policies can hinder productivity gains. Successful implementations typically begin with monitoring-only deployments to establish baseline behaviors before implementing graduated controls based on actual risk patterns.

Integration with Existing Security Stack
Teramind should be integrated with existing security information and event management (SIEM) systems, data loss prevention (DLP) solutions, and identity management platforms to create a cohesive security posture.

Practical Deployment Recommendations

Based on search results from enterprise deployment case studies and technical documentation:

  1. Start with Discovery Phase: Deploy monitoring capabilities first to understand current AI usage patterns across the organization before implementing controls.

  2. Develop Risk-Based Policies: Create AI usage policies that reflect actual business risks rather than blanket restrictions, focusing protection on genuinely sensitive data and high-risk operations.

  3. Implement Graduated Controls: Begin with warning systems for policy violations before implementing blocking controls, allowing users to adapt to new governance requirements.

  4. Establish Clear Governance Roles: Define responsibilities for AI policy management, incident response, and compliance reporting within existing IT governance structures.

  5. Regular Review and Adjustment: AI governance should be regularly reviewed and adjusted based on evolving business needs, technological developments, and regulatory changes.
